100个初学者必研究的小程序(2)
"100个初学者必研究的小程序(2)"主要针对的是初学者,旨在通过一系列小程序的学习,帮助他们快速掌握编程基础。这个系列分为三个部分,本部分为第二部分,意味着它在前一部分的基础上进行了深入或扩展,为学习者提供了更丰富的实践项目。 提到的"3部分"表明这是一个系统的教程,逐步递进,让学习者在每个阶段都能获得新的挑战和知识。作为"第2部分",它可能包含了对第一部分知识的巩固和深化,也可能引入了新的编程概念和技术,旨在逐步提升初学者的编程能力。 ".NET"明确了这个系列主要关注的是微软的.NET框架,这是一个用于构建各种类型的应用程序的开发平台。.NET框架包括C#、VB.NET、F#等编程语言,以及ASP.NET(用于Web应用开发)和Windows Forms(用于桌面应用开发)等技术。因此,我们可以预期这100个小程序将围绕这些.NET相关的技术展开。 在【压缩包子文件的文件名称列表】中,我们看到"100个asp初学者必研究的小程序(2)",这表明这个部分的重点是ASP.NET。ASP.NET是.NET框架的一部分,用于构建动态网页和Web应用程序。它提供了诸如控件、状态管理、数据绑定等特性,使得Web开发变得更加高效和便捷。 在学习这部分内容时,初学者可以期待以下知识点: 1. ASP.NET基本概念:了解ASP.NET的架构,包括页生命周期、请求处理流程以及服务器控件。 2. Razor语法:学习如何使用Razor视图引擎编写高效的代码,结合HTML和C#或VB.NET。 3. 控件使用:掌握各种服务器控件如Label、TextBox、Button等,以及它们在页面交互中的作用。 4. 数据绑定:学习如何绑定数据到控件,例如GridView、ListView等,以显示和操作数据库中的数据。 5. 状态管理:理解Session、ViewState和Cookie等状态管理机制,以及何时使用它们。 6. 静态和动态路由:了解如何配置和使用URL路由来创建友好的和可自定义的URL结构。 7. 用户身份验证和授权:学习如何实现用户登录、注册和权限控制,以保护Web应用的安全。 8. AJAX和jQuery:掌握如何使用ASP.NET AJAX扩展和jQuery库来实现页面的部分更新和增强用户体验。 9. WebAPI和RESTful服务:了解如何使用ASP.NET WebAPI创建RESTful服务,以便与其他客户端(如移动应用或桌面应用)进行交互。 10. 部署和调试:学习如何将ASP.NET应用程序部署到服务器,并使用Visual Studio进行调试。 通过这个系列的学习,初学者不仅可以掌握ASP.NET的核心概念和技术,还能通过实践提高问题解决能力和编程思维。同时,这也为他们进一步学习更复杂的.NET技术和框架,如ASP.NET Core,打下坚实的基础。
- 1
- 2
- 粉丝: 1
- 资源: 14
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助